The tagline that feels really right for me is this one:

"Precisely Planned - Delicately Designed"

 

First of all it sounds good, and it's easy to remember because of the first letters being repeated PP - DD. It sums up the whole process and the two adjectives give a feeling of high quality work and also of caring because of the word "delicately". I think it will resonate with architects because they basically do these two steps too. So I think that when they read this tagline they will feel like there's a connection, that we're not so different and that it will be great to work together. The more I think of it, the more similarities I can find between architects and brand designers.
